材料科学家 are materials engineering professionals who are also experts in materials science. As materials scientists, they work to develop, process, and enhance materials. They focus on the atomic and molecular structure of matter, as their work is important in many different fields, from automotive to aerospace and biomedicine. These professionals are responsible for some of the most groundbreaking advancements in our technology today—and will be responsible for many more in the future.
Education and Background
The path to a career as a 材料科学家 generally includes a degree in materials science and engineering, materials engineering, or chemical engineering. Materials science programs may also be found within physics and chemistry departments. A doctoral degree is not typically required, but it can open up more research and development opportunities. Materials scientists can also come from different backgrounds, so those with a background in a related field may be able to move into the field and apply their current knowledge and skills.
There are many different ways to learn about materials science through online courses. These courses would help learners build up their knowledge base in the materials science and engineering field, including courses that are in materials characterization, materials testing, and thermodynamics.
